Transaction 643d7b2c8616213086e066d6c2300ccffdf498a424e374791e62fd42be038de9

1 Input
2 Outputs
  • 643d7b2c8616213086e066d6c2300ccffdf498a424e374791e62fd42be038de9:0
  • value  54933481
    address  38JcDA9mD7XNUj3KKHMKNqF4aaFVXbe429
  • 643d7b2c8616213086e066d6c2300ccffdf498a424e374791e62fd42be038de9:1
  • value  15734748
    address  3NoNW1supsruqj5pHRFCm91ZEnpfvFTpNe